Course information

What makes a successful development? Who is involved and what are their expectations? Will the building stand the test of time? In order to answer these questions and provide a successful development strategy you need to understand the fundamentals of the development process, from the initial concept through to deciding to build the scheme.  

Learning outcomes

  •  Identify the fundamentals of the development process and the valuation of development land.
  • Manage the process, up to the start of construction, either as an agent, other advisor or as the developer.
  • Recognise the interactions between the different issues at the various stages of the development management process.
  • Assess different methods of valuing development land and when to use the different types of appraisals.
  • Recognise the different methodologies for the assessment of both project and financial risk.
  • Analyse types of development finance and how they can be accounted for in the valuation.
